About the Artist
Oleksandra Rudolph (hlole) is a contemporary artist exploring form, color, texture, and emotional space through abstract compositions. Her work is rooted in a deep sensitivity to inner states and natural rhythms, combining intuitive expression with professional craftsmanship.
She is an actively exhibiting artist, regularly participating in exhibitions across Europe, including Germany and Italy. Her works have been shown in both group and personal exhibitions and continue to be presented to an international audience.
⸻
Exhibitions
• 01.11.2024 – 31.01.2025 — Personal exhibition, Calau, Germany
• 10.12.2024 – 10.01.2025 — “Inner Freedom: Reflections on the Abstract Soul”, Galleryone962
• 07.02.2025 – 21.02.2025 — “Utopie e Distopie”, Galleria Cael, Milan, Italy
